Definition
The Cap Sorter/Orienter is a critical component within an Aseptic Capping Unit that receives bulk caps, sorts them to ensure uniformity, and orients them in the correct position for precise placement onto containers. It maintains sterility by operating within the unit's controlled environment and ensures caps are properly aligned for secure sealing. The component is designed for food manufacturing environments, with materials such as stainless steel (AISI 304/316) and food-grade plastics (e.g., polycarbonate, POM) that meet hygiene requirements. Silicone/EPDM seals are used to maintain sterility and prevent contamination. The sorter/orienter handles caps with diameters ranging from 20 to 80 mm, achieving a capacity of 100–300 caps per minute, depending on cap size and orientation complexity. Orientation accuracy is maintained within ±0.5°, ensuring precise placement. The component operates under a pressure of 1.0–1.6 MPa, with air consumption of 0.5–1.5 m³/min, and requires a 24 V DC supply (±10%) with power consumption of 50–150 W. It is designed for an operating temperature range of 0–50 °C and offers ingress protection rated IP54–IP65 (IEC 60529). The material for food contact is stainless steel 304/316L (ASTM A240). The component weighs 50–120 kg and has typical dimensions of 800×600×1200 mm (L×W×H). Working Principle
Caps are fed from a hopper into a sorting mechanism (e.g., vibratory bowl, centrifugal disc) that separates and aligns them. Orientation is achieved through mechanical guides, sensors, or vision systems that detect cap features (e.g., threads, tabs) and rotate them to the correct position before transfer to the capping station. The sorting mechanism ensures uniformity, while the orientation system uses feedback to correct any misalignment. The component operates within the controlled environment of the aseptic capping unit to maintain sterility. The process is continuous, with caps moving from bulk storage to precise placement. The system's accuracy depends on sensor calibration and mechanical adjustment. Regular inspection of guides and sensors is necessary to maintain performance. The component is designed to handle a range of cap sizes, and changeover may require adjustments to the sorting and orientation mechanisms.

Components / BOM
  • Vibratory Bowl Feeder
    Separates and aligns caps from bulk supply using vibration
    Material: Stainless Steel
  • Orientation Sensor
    Detects cap position and triggers rotation if misaligned
    Material: Stainless Steel Housing, Optical Components
  • Rejection Mechanism
    Removes misaligned or defective caps from the line
    Material: Stainless Steel, Pneumatic Components
  • Mechanical Guides
    Rails and cutouts that turn caps to the right attitude as they pass.
  • Vision System Optional
    Reads cap features optically to decide orientation, on vision-equipped sorters.
  • Centrifugal Disc Optional
    Separates caps by spinning them outward instead of by vibration, on disc-type sorters.

Reliability & Engineering Risk Analysis

Failure Mode & Root Cause
Belt misalignment and wear
Cause: Improper tensioning, worn pulleys, or accumulation of debris causing tracking issues, leading to accelerated belt degradation and potential jamming.
Sensor or actuator failure
Cause: Environmental contamination (dust, moisture), mechanical shock, or electrical interference disrupting cap detection, orientation, or sorting mechanisms.
Maintenance Indicators
  • Audible grinding or squealing noises from drive components
  • Visible misalignment of caps or increased rejection rates
Engineering Tips
  • Implement routine cleaning and inspection schedules to prevent debris buildup on belts, sensors, and guides.
  • Use precision alignment tools during installation and maintenance to ensure optimal belt and component positioning.
